Earlier in 2018, Techstars, in partnership with The Nature Conservancy launched the first class of the three-month Techstars Sustainability Accelerator program. The mentorship-based program based in Denver, Colorado helps entrepreneurs scale-up technology that is solving for a sustainable future across food, water and climate change.
With the world’s population projected to grow to 10 billion people by 2050, technological innovation is essential if we want to live in a world where people have the food, water, energy and economic growth they need without sacrificing nature. This collaboration between traditionally disconnected sectors is looking to be a driver of smart solutions to achieve the path to sustainability.
